From eb8bca812efc17b975864d87a734c0dd520df618 Mon Sep 17 00:00:00 2001 From: Jeremy Johnson Date: Fri, 17 Jun 2022 13:06:29 +0100 Subject: Updating CONST tests for v0.30.0 release Signed-off-by: Jeremy Johnson Change-Id: I528c7427b388429f73b3915ab1d529c3f2ea690d --- .../const/const_6x44_i16/Conformance-const-0.json | 281 ++++++++++ .../data_nodes/const/const_6x44_i16/desc.json | 16 + .../data_nodes/const/const_6x44_i16/test.json | 571 +++++++++++++++++++++ 3 files changed, 868 insertions(+) create mode 100644 operators/data_nodes/const/const_6x44_i16/Conformance-const-0.json create mode 100644 operators/data_nodes/const/const_6x44_i16/desc.json create mode 100644 operators/data_nodes/const/const_6x44_i16/test.json (limited to 'operators/data_nodes/const/const_6x44_i16') diff --git a/operators/data_nodes/const/const_6x44_i16/Conformance-const-0.json b/operators/data_nodes/const/const_6x44_i16/Conformance-const-0.json new file mode 100644 index 000000000..8c6043b17 --- /dev/null +++ b/operators/data_nodes/const/const_6x44_i16/Conformance-const-0.json @@ -0,0 +1,281 @@ +{ + "type": "int32", + "data": [ + [ + -26603, + 17840, + 25536, + 10316, + -6881, + -22282, + 11965, + -2045, + -22979, + -9198, + 30248, + -15376, + -21074, + 11925, + -19691, + 27519, + 23526, + 31688, + 27039, + -16793, + -18865, + -10313, + -1980, + 24903, + 15302, + 9465, + 24796, + 9560, + -7927, + -5702, + 1115, + -26951, + 15841, + 10012, + 15147, + 2224, + 18544, + 29474, + 4583, + -3645, + -25912, + 18263, + 26474, + 13073 + ], + [ + 23958, + 23671, + 19536, + 188, + -26224, + -32556, + -19373, + -4521, + 15964, + -2897, + -31252, + -18983, + 31406, + 31983, + -8052, + 19987, + 14372, + 28263, + 25399, + 8437, + -6906, + 8300, + -11854, + -9956, + 7126, + 4679, + 5307, + -7558, + -5955, + -32101, + 6669, + 4966, + 28533, + 280, + -2121, + -28333, + -19875, + -10615, + -8048, + -9000, + -6940, + 17623, + -24176, + -10994 + ], + [ + -22095, + -12597, + 12095, + -29704, + -10520, + -31216, + 29812, + 14893, + -16804, + -19779, + -26285, + -1778, + 16613, + 5518, + 24971, + -10236, + -14542, + -1439, + -19524, + 31171, + -20594, + -1385, + 1442, + -29030, + -2070, + -2969, + -15766, + -24382, + -29808, + -32206, + -1213, + -26881, + 30102, + -16729, + 9995, + 11369, + -295, + 25140, + -25514, + -17431, + -16225, + -23894, + -13450, + -12276 + ], + [ + 17354, + -13001, + 24688, + 17869, + 26322, + -25872, + 31756, + 7468, + 31612, + -9514, + 29687, + 5806, + -28062, + -5891, + -23738, + 28919, + -12815, + -18196, + 3466, + -4905, + -26413, + 20741, + 22662, + 15922, + 7651, + -6386, + 2776, + 1376, + -21935, + -27407, + -16171, + -2993, + -22262, + -25778, + 23064, + -8193, + 5519, + 1574, + 15409, + 15716, + -13368, + 22800, + -8438, + 21968 + ], + [ + -6236, + -25494, + 17040, + -30792, + 17848, + -29940, + -19215, + 6774, + 28936, + -5999, + -24861, + -17505, + 25960, + 14859, + -26189, + -7544, + -15432, + -21114, + 22706, + 7714, + -21005, + 9875, + -5665, + -28740, + -3287, + -20629, + -16695, + 24838, + 13778, + -23981, + 23025, + 4869, + 24548, + 16192, + -10531, + 2285, + 2021, + 14414, + -16489, + -10939, + -16726, + -13360, + -22201, + -30373 + ], + [ + 28837, + -27898, + 25427, + -32567, + 18176, + -11246, + 1157, + -14273, + -616, + -3175, + 1949, + -6994, + 2396, + 21329, + -4289, + -9085, + -24134, + -9194, + -24533, + -20808, + 29638, + -26909, + -1178, + 21908, + 29701, + -23153, + -22048, + -8350, + 3566, + 30133, + -19156, + -21995, + -16176, + 24531, + -30799, + -7856, + -24973, + -22475, + 27318, + -32660, + -11697, + 27225, + 7086, + -28066 + ] + ] +} \ No newline at end of file diff --git a/operators/data_nodes/const/const_6x44_i16/desc.json b/operators/data_nodes/const/const_6x44_i16/desc.json new file mode 100644 index 000000000..58ee2e73c --- /dev/null +++ b/operators/data_nodes/const/const_6x44_i16/desc.json @@ -0,0 +1,16 @@ +{ + "tosa_file": "test.json", + "ifm_name": [], + "ifm_file": [], + "ofm_name": [ + "const-0" + ], + "ofm_file": [ + "const-0.npy" + ], + "expected_return_code": 0, + "expected_failure": false, + "expected_result_file": [ + "Conformance-const-0.npy" + ] +} \ No newline at end of file diff --git a/operators/data_nodes/const/const_6x44_i16/test.json b/operators/data_nodes/const/const_6x44_i16/test.json new file mode 100644 index 000000000..b0cbff0e5 --- /dev/null +++ b/operators/data_nodes/const/const_6x44_i16/test.json @@ -0,0 +1,571 @@ +{ + version: { + _major: 0, + _minor: 30, + _patch: 0, + _draft: false + }, + blocks: [ + { + name: "main", + operators: [ + { + op: "CONST", + attribute_type: "NONE", + inputs: [ + + ], + outputs: [ + "const-0" + ] + } + ], + tensors: [ + { + name: "const-0", + shape: [ + 6, + 44 + ], + type: "INT16", + data: [ + 21, + 152, + 176, + 69, + 192, + 99, + 76, + 40, + 31, + 229, + 246, + 168, + 189, + 46, + 3, + 248, + 61, + 166, + 18, + 220, + 40, + 118, + 240, + 195, + 174, + 173, + 149, + 46, + 21, + 179, + 127, + 107, + 230, + 91, + 200, + 123, + 159, + 105, + 103, + 190, + 79, + 182, + 183, + 215, + 68, + 248, + 71, + 97, + 198, + 59, + 249, + 36, + 220, + 96, + 88, + 37, + 9, + 225, + 186, + 233, + 91, + 4, + 185, + 150, + 225, + 61, + 28, + 39, + 43, + 59, + 176, + 8, + 112, + 72, + 34, + 115, + 231, + 17, + 195, + 241, + 200, + 154, + 87, + 71, + 106, + 103, + 17, + 51, + 150, + 93, + 119, + 92, + 80, + 76, + 188, + 0, + 144, + 153, + 212, + 128, + 83, + 180, + 87, + 238, + 92, + 62, + 175, + 244, + 236, + 133, + 217, + 181, + 174, + 122, + 239, + 124, + 140, + 224, + 19, + 78, + 36, + 56, + 103, + 110, + 55, + 99, + 245, + 32, + 6, + 229, + 108, + 32, + 178, + 209, + 28, + 217, + 214, + 27, + 71, + 18, + 187, + 20, + 122, + 226, + 189, + 232, + 155, + 130, + 13, + 26, + 102, + 19, + 117, + 111, + 24, + 1, + 183, + 247, + 83, + 145, + 93, + 178, + 137, + 214, + 144, + 224, + 216, + 220, + 228, + 228, + 215, + 68, + 144, + 161, + 14, + 213, + 177, + 169, + 203, + 206, + 63, + 47, + 248, + 139, + 232, + 214, + 16, + 134, + 116, + 116, + 45, + 58, + 92, + 190, + 189, + 178, + 83, + 153, + 14, + 249, + 229, + 64, + 142, + 21, + 139, + 97, + 4, + 216, + 50, + 199, + 97, + 250, + 188, + 179, + 195, + 121, + 142, + 175, + 151, + 250, + 162, + 5, + 154, + 142, + 234, + 247, + 103, + 244, + 106, + 194, + 194, + 160, + 144, + 139, + 50, + 130, + 67, + 251, + 255, + 150, + 150, + 117, + 167, + 190, + 11, + 39, + 105, + 44, + 217, + 254, + 52, + 98, + 86, + 156, + 233, + 187, + 159, + 192, + 170, + 162, + 118, + 203, + 12, + 208, + 202, + 67, + 55, + 205, + 112, + 96, + 205, + 69, + 210, + 102, + 240, + 154, + 12, + 124, + 44, + 29, + 124, + 123, + 214, + 218, + 247, + 115, + 174, + 22, + 98, + 146, + 253, + 232, + 70, + 163, + 247, + 112, + 241, + 205, + 236, + 184, + 138, + 13, + 215, + 236, + 211, + 152, + 5, + 81, + 134, + 88, + 50, + 62, + 227, + 29, + 14, + 231, + 216, + 10, + 96, + 5, + 81, + 170, + 241, + 148, + 213, + 192, + 79, + 244, + 10, + 169, + 78, + 155, + 24, + 90, + 255, + 223, + 143, + 21, + 38, + 6, + 49, + 60, + 100, + 61, + 200, + 203, + 16, + 89, + 10, + 223, + 208, + 85, + 164, + 231, + 106, + 156, + 144, + 66, + 184, + 135, + 184, + 69, + 12, + 139, + 241, + 180, + 118, + 26, + 8, + 113, + 145, + 232, + 227, + 158, + 159, + 187, + 104, + 101, + 11, + 58, + 179, + 153, + 136, + 226, + 184, + 195, + 134, + 173, + 178, + 88, + 34, + 30, + 243, + 173, + 147, + 38, + 223, + 233, + 188, + 143, + 41, + 243, + 107, + 175, + 201, + 190, + 6, + 97, + 210, + 53, + 83, + 162, + 241, + 89, + 5, + 19, + 228, + 95, + 64, + 63, + 221, + 214, + 237, + 8, + 229, + 7, + 78, + 56, + 151, + 191, + 69, + 213, + 170, + 190, + 208, + 203, + 71, + 169, + 91, + 137, + 165, + 112, + 6, + 147, + 83, + 99, + 201, + 128, + 0, + 71, + 18, + 212, + 133, + 4, + 63, + 200, + 152, + 253, + 153, + 243, + 157, + 7, + 174, + 228, + 92, + 9, + 81, + 83, + 63, + 239, + 131, + 220, + 186, + 161, + 22, + 220, + 43, + 160, + 184, + 174, + 198, + 115, + 227, + 150, + 102, + 251, + 148, + 85, + 5, + 116, + 143, + 165, + 224, + 169, + 98, + 223, + 238, + 13, + 181, + 117, + 44, + 181, + 21, + 170, + 208, + 192, + 211, + 95, + 177, + 135, + 80, + 225, + 115, + 158, + 53, + 168, + 182, + 106, + 108, + 128, + 79, + 210, + 89, + 106, + 174, + 27, + 94, + 146 + ] + } + ], + inputs: [ + + ], + outputs: [ + "const-0" + ] + } + ] +} -- cgit v1.2.1